John Baldwin 4fb369f815 - Move all of the hwvol functions into a mixer_hwvol_* namespace, and make
all of the hwvol members of struct snd_mixer live in a hwvol_* namespace.
- When changing the mixer device via the hwvol_mixer sysctl, reset the
  muted state so that a mute operation on a new device won't try to
  unmute the new device with the old device's saved volume.
- When the volume is muted, if a down or up volume request is received,
  first restore the saved volume level and then adjust it.

Reviewed by:	cg
2001-01-11 23:26:16 +00:00
..
2001-01-11 15:35:45 +00:00
2000-12-30 22:06:19 +00:00
2001-01-09 04:32:24 +00:00
2001-01-11 15:35:45 +00:00
2000-12-31 10:24:19 +00:00
2001-01-11 23:05:34 +00:00
2001-01-08 09:17:58 +00:00
2001-01-09 19:15:12 +00:00
2000-05-01 20:32:07 +00:00